MINING NEWS: Neighboring prospects get new lookNew Alaska exploration manager for Kinross plans early-stage exploration work on gold occurrences near Fort Knox, True North Patricia Liles Mining News Editor
In his first season as the Alaska and Russia exploration manager for Kinross Gold, Rich Harris will be spending about $2.5 million on exploration in 2004, mostly for early-stage prospects neighboring the company’s Fort Knox and True North mines northeast of Fairbanks, Alaska.
